Output 01476875127c27f04109a79350f9b617c40b71d3ac7921f2ed3af90daf424f5f:28

value
33483
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fae144a8ae8ecad0fde9cb476093284c7a1aac24 OP_EQUAL
address
3QZYiQkDD1Qt64tBHVzN92Housbfu4GrKS
transaction
01476875127c27f04109a79350f9b617c40b71d3ac7921f2ed3af90daf424f5f
confirmations
20956
spent
true